The Talent Acquisition Specialist is responsible for sourcing candidates through various channels, planning interview and selection procedures, hosting or participating in career events, developing long-term recruiting strategies, nurturing trusting relationships with potential hires and creating strong talent pipelines for the assigned community’s and company’s current and future hiring needs.
Education/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or related field.
- Must have excellent analytical, computer and organizational skills.
- Minimum of one (1) year related recruiting experience or long-term care is preferred.
